Neighborhood Council budgets are in danger of total elimination today (2/1)! The City Council Budget and Finance Committee is meeting Monday, February 1st at 1pm.

Los Angeles CAO Miguel Santana is expected to propose the total elimination of neighborhood council budget allocations plus the sweeping of all rollover funds.
Please contact your City representatives and tell them to continue funding our local governments! At risk are important programs such as:
FALL FESTIVAL
SUPPORT FOR LOCAL SCHOOLS
MAR VISTA PARK AMENITIES
MAR VISTA LIBRARY
OUR PUBLIC STAIRS
LAPD EXPLORER PROGRAM
SAVING OUR HISTORIC FS 62
GREENING MAR VISTA
EXTRA GRAFFITTI REMOVAL
